Why Choose an Online Real Estate Law Course?

Before we jump into the reviews of specific courses, let’s discuss why opting for an online real estate law course might be a smart move.

Flexibility and Convenience

Online courses provide the flexibility to learn at your own pace and schedule, which is particularly valuable for working professionals or students with busy schedules. You can balance work, study, and personal life more effectively.

Access to Top Instructors

Many online real estate law courses are taught by experienced legal professionals and academic experts from renowned institutions. This means you can gain insights and knowledge from the best in the field without the need to relocate or commute.

Cost-Effective

Online courses often come at a fraction of the cost of traditional, in-person education. Additionally, there are no expenses related to transportation, accommodation, or course materials, making it a more budget-friendly option.

Comprehensive Curriculum

Top online real estate law courses provide a comprehensive curriculum covering essential topics such as property rights, contracts, zoning laws, compliance, and litigation. These courses are designed to equip you with practical knowledge and skills that can be directly applied in real-world situations.

How to Choose the Right Online Real Estate Law Course

With so many options available, selecting the right course may seem overwhelming. Here are some factors to consider when choosing the best online real estate law course for your needs:

1. Course Content and Curriculum

Ensure the course covers the key areas of real estate law you need to focus on. Look for a comprehensive curriculum that addresses fundamental and advanced topics relevant to your career goals.

2. Instructor Credentials

Check the qualifications and experience of the course instructors. Courses taught by renowned legal experts or professionals with real-world experience are often more valuable.

3. Flexibility and Format

Consider the format and flexibility of the course. Self-paced courses may be more suitable for those with busy schedules, while interactive courses with live sessions may provide a richer learning experience.

4. Cost and Value

Evaluate the cost of the course against its value. Free or affordable courses can be great for foundational knowledge, while more expensive courses may offer advanced insights and prestigious certifications.

5. Alumni Reviews and Ratings

Look for reviews and ratings from previous students. Positive feedback and high ratings can indicate a well-designed and effective course.
